Output 43c8276ef18ab5f184b33cd0c056bd2a50c95ea5131865bfcc8748cdd7c9e8f1:0

value
2479066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28d3b97943ea5ed0a874eaa2102c072277cd3ee6 OP_EQUAL
address
35Qtb6P5z9hRiAgNdNFxjaVmGoZ5YwDBqu
transaction
43c8276ef18ab5f184b33cd0c056bd2a50c95ea5131865bfcc8748cdd7c9e8f1
spent
true